India’s quest for global power represents a significant shift in its foreign policy landscape. Prime Minister Narendra Modi has emphasized the need for India to move beyond its traditional role as a balancing force and assume a leading position on the world stage. This change in perspective reflects India’s growing self-confidence and aspirations for a more active and influential role in international affairs. The country has been unapologetic in pursuing its national interests, which include standing up for its sovereignty and territorial integrity. The “Make in India” campaign, for instance, seeks to reduce India’s dependence on imports, boost domestic manufacturing, and create jobs, thereby reinforcing India’s economic and strategic independence. India’s foreign policy has also demonstrated its ability to handle complex international issues. Be it the border tensions with China or the situation in the Indian Ocean region, India has shown a strong and resolute stance in protecting its interests. India’s relationship with the United States has also grown stronger in recent years. The U.S.-India partnership is now characterized by cooperation in various areas, including defense, trade, and counterterrorism. This alignment of interests has strengthened India’s position in the global arena.

To become a true global power, India is trying to address the structural barriers that have hindered its progress. Key among these is the need to implement comprehensive economic reforms that create efficient product and factor markets. India has immense untapped potential, but its economy has been hampered by excessive regulation and a lack of innovation. By streamlining regulations and fostering a more conducive environment for entrepreneurship, India can unlock its full economic potential and achieve sustained growth. India’s aspirations for global power cannot be realized in isolation. The country must cultivate strong relationships with key global players, particularly the United States. The U.S. remains a critical source of capital, technology, and expertise for India. By nurturing robust ties with the U.S. and strengthening alliances with other key partners in Asia and beyond, India can access invaluable support and resources that will bolster its global ambitions. One of the key dynamics shaping India’s quest for global power is its relationship with China. As India’s powerful neighbor, China’s rise has been a cause for concern and competition.
India’s strategic positioning and growing capabilities offer a potential counterweight to China’s dominance in the region. However, India’s proximity to China also poses challenges and necessitates careful navigation of geopolitical complexities.
